Output faab89554f9578db2c8cd00ed35d71388ddda6207d4e7335cd992a31d632f030:0

value
2013000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 285631eafeaecd0e45d246f469551e16034def28 OP_EQUAL
address
35NJD9esoX7H2jewp7Nwrao12HMn1S9Lmi
transaction
faab89554f9578db2c8cd00ed35d71388ddda6207d4e7335cd992a31d632f030
confirmations
166755
spent
true